## Setup

This skill requires the `AISA_API_KEY` environment variable. When installed as a Claude plugin, the key is configured via the plugin's `userConfig`.

## Usage

Run the search client with the `scholar` subcommand:

```bash theme={null}
python3 ${CLAUDE_PLUGIN_ROOT}/skills/scholar-search/scripts/search_client.py scholar --query "<academic query>" --count <max_results> [--year-from YYYY] [--year-to YYYY]
```

### Arguments

| Argument         | Required | Default | Description                       |
| ---------------- | -------- | ------- | --------------------------------- |
| `--query` / `-q` | Yes      | —       | Academic search query             |
| `--count` / `-c` | No       | 10      | Maximum number of results (1–100) |
| `--year-from`    | No       | —       | Year lower bound (e.g., 2023)     |
| `--year-to`      | No       | —       | Year upper bound (e.g., 2026)     |

### Examples

```bash theme={null}
# Search for recent transformer papers
python3 ${CLAUDE_PLUGIN_ROOT}/skills/scholar-search/scripts/search_client.py scholar --query "transformer architecture attention mechanism" --count 10 --year-from 2024

# Search papers in a specific year range
python3 ${CLAUDE_PLUGIN_ROOT}/skills/scholar-search/scripts/search_client.py scholar --query "reinforcement learning from human feedback" --year-from 2022 --year-to 2025
```

## Output

The script prints structured academic results including:

* **Title** — Paper title
* **URL** — Link to the paper or abstract
* **Publication info** — Journal, conference, or preprint source
* **Snippet** — Abstract excerpt
